1. Regularly Clean Your Rims to Prevent Corrosion
Dirt, brake dust, and grime accumulate on your rims, creating a breeding ground for corrosion. Cleaning your rims frequently protects their finish and prevents long-term damage.
- Use a pH-balanced wheel cleaner to dissolve dirt and grime without damaging the rim surface.
- Scrub gently with a soft-bristle brush to remove stubborn debris.
- Rinse thoroughly and dry with a microfiber cloth to avoid water spots.
Pro Tip: Clean your rims after driving through muddy or rainy conditions to prevent dirt from embedding into the surface.
2. Apply a Protective Coating to Prevent Oxidation
Ceramic coatings and wheel sealants create a durable layer that shields your rims from harsh road elements. These coatings:
- Repel dirt, water, and brake dust.
- Protect against UV damage from Tulsa’s intense sunlight.
- Prevent oxidation and rust buildup.
Pro Tip: Opt for a ceramic coating that provides long-lasting protection and enhances your rim’s natural shine.
3. Avoid Harsh Cleaning Chemicals and Abrasive Brushes
Using household cleaners or rough brushes can strip away your rim’s protective coating, leaving the surface vulnerable to damage. Always use:
- Non-acidic, wheel-safe cleaners.
- Microfiber cloths or soft-bristle brushes to prevent scratches.
Tip: Avoid using dish soap or abrasive sponges, as they can deteriorate the rim’s finish over time.
4. Check Tire Pressure Regularly to Avoid Rim Stress
Underinflated or overinflated tires put unnecessary pressure on your rims, increasing the risk of cracks and bends. Proper tire pressure ensures an even distribution of weight, minimizing rim stress.
- Check tire pressure monthly or before long drives.
- Follow manufacturer guidelines for the recommended PSI.
Pro Tip: Regularly inspecting tire pressure also improves fuel efficiency and tire longevity.
5. Be Mindful of Road Hazards and Avoid Potholes
Potholes are one of the leading causes of rim damage in Tulsa. Sudden impacts can dent, crack, or warp your rims, resulting in costly repairs.
- Slow down when approaching unfamiliar roads or construction zones.
- Avoid driving through standing water, as hidden potholes may lurk beneath.
Pro Tip: If hitting a pothole is unavoidable, hold the steering wheel firmly and avoid sudden braking to reduce impact.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Caring for Your Rims
🚫
Ignoring Minor Scratches: Small imperfections can lead to long-term corrosion if left untreated.
🚫
Using Harsh Cleaning Products: Acidic or abrasive cleaners can strip away the rim’s protective coating.
🚫
Delaying Professional Repairs: Waiting too long to address damage can lead to more extensive and expensive repairs.
